Why a part of Chepauk Palace is called as Khalsa Mahal?

  • Here are the details of Chepauk Palace : (http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Chepauk_Palace  ) Chepauk Palace was the official residence of the Nawab of Arcot from 1768 to 1855. It is situated in the neighbourhood of Chepauk in Chennai, India . The Chepauk Palace comprises two blocks—the northern block is known as  Khalsa Mahal while the southern block is known as Humayun Mahal.http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Chepauk_Palace#cite_note-srinivasacharip181-1 The palace is built over an area of 117 acres and is surrounded by a wallia and is constructed in the Indo-Saracenic style of architecture.

  • Answer:

    With some Googling, I found that it is not called Khalsa Mahal but rather called "Kalsa Mahal" (Kalsa probably comes from the word Kalas meaning dome) The main palace consisted of two blocks, the  southern called the Kalsa Mahal, so called from its small domes  and the northern, called the Humayun Mahal and the Diwan  Khana the last of which contained the Durbar Hall. Source: https://archive.org/stream/historyofthecity035512mbp/historyofthecity035512mbp_djvu.txt I have updated the Wikipedia page to avoid further confusion.
